The FDD has petitioned the Anti-Corruption Commission to investigate the failed attempt by the government to conceal the $192 million loan from China.

And the FDD says while president Edgar Lungu enjoys immunity from prosecution, he can be prosecuted for crimes he commits as minister of Defence.

Lungu is both president and minister of defence.

FDD spokesperson Antonio Mwanza told the ACC that the contraction of the loan from an obscure Chinese firm was shady.

Mwanza contended that the secretive contraction of the loan was done outside government laid down procedure. He said that all Zambian government expenditure should be approved by parliament as required by the laws of the country.

Mwanza said the ACC should investigate the suspicious deal just like the investigated the other arms deal involving Katebe Katoto.
